PRESENTATION OF STA

STA SA, founded in 2001, aims to contribute to improving the nutritional status of the most vulnerable children, in particular by manufacturing products for the treatment or prevention of malnutrition, and to develop products adapted to the eating habits of the people of Niger.

STA was created as a successor to the ‘VITAMIL’ production facility set up in 1991 by CARITAS NIGER with subsidies from the Dutch Royal Tropical Institute (KIT) in order to support the government’s activities concerning infant nutrition.

Message from the Founder Dr. Fatchima Cissé

“In the Ottawa Charter, the World Health Organisation (WHO) defined the promotion of health as an approach aiming to give people greater control over their health and to ensure their physical well-being. STA’s approach is to support people by developing nutritional products (complementary, preventive, treatments), as malnutrition is the main aggravating factor in disease. Specifically, we manufacture products for children in the most vulnerable age bracket, from 6 months to 5 years old. Our mission is enshrined in our positioning in the field of health. It is therefore essential that the basic principles of infantile nutrition laid down by the WHO should be respected. The key factors in our success are the availability of the products, the ease of use and the price/quality ratio. In this way we make our contribution to the promotion of health, and to the socio-economic development of Niger and of the entire sub-region.”
